Philippines celebrates month for Blessed Mother, moms



IN keeping with an old tradition, the Philippines celebrates the month of May as the month of mothers and the Blessed Mother.

Sunday, Mother’s Day, special prayer services in honor of mothers were held in Catholic churches across the country. Offerings will be dedicated to the Blessed Virgin Mary, revered as the mother of Jesus, the mother of the Church, and the mother of all mankind.
